## Deployment

Togglecrest ships as a single stateless binary behind the Marrowgate ingress tier. Deploys go through the canary lane first: five percent of evaluation traffic for thirty minutes, then full promotion if error rates hold. Rollbacks are a redeploy of the previous artifact — flag state lives in the datastore, not the binary, so no flag definitions are lost. Before the sync, confirm that every node in the pool has converged on the configuration values listed below.

service settings:
PRAIX_LOG_LEVEL=error
PRAIX_METRICS_HOST=metrics.praix.qorvelcorp.corp
PRAIX_POOL_SIZE=16

## Changelog — Fieldnote Surveyor v6.0 defaults

Offline mode is now enabled by default. New installs cache survey schemas locally and queue submissions until connectivity returns; plugins must tolerate deferred sync callbacks. The previous always-online behavior remains available via override. Plugin authors should validate against the new default configuration, shown below.

deployment values, tahag-fajof:
[drudor]
port = 6379
region = outer-3
host = drudor.zarqelhq.internal
team = fraox
timeout_ms = 3000
retries = 7

**Key Ceremony Checklist — Item 7 (Glasshaven Controller)**

Welcome aboard! Before you sign the ceremony log, sanity-check the greenhouse sensors. The Glasshaven humidity probes drift upward about 2% per month, so if Bay 3 reads swampy, it's probably lying. Recalibrate against the handheld reference, note the offset in the ledger, and only then proceed — we don't want a key ceremony interrupted by a bogus climate alarm locking the vestibule. Once drift is logged and signed off, recover the ceremony console with the passphrase below.

vault phrase of kawep-tahog = ulaix-briath